The term "man down" is something commonly used in the military to signify that a soldier is hurt, incapacitated, or dead. Most likely they are laying on the ground, hence the term "man down".

What does the term 'G Man' typically refer to?

The term G-Man is a form of slang. The word G-Man stands for Government Man, and refers to the special agents of the United States. It is typically used to refer to FBI agents.

What term do scholars use to refer to biological differences between man and woman?

Scholars use the term "sexual dimorphism" to refer to biological differences between men and women. This term encompasses differences in physical characteristics such as body structure, reproductive anatomy, and hormonal profiles.
